#d34c51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d34c51 is composed of 82.7% red, 29.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64% magenta, 61.6%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 357.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 56.3%. #d34c51 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98a2 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#d34c51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d34c51 has RGB values of R:211, G:76,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.62,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13847633.

Shades and Tints of #d34c51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0203 is the darkest color, while #fef9f9 is the lightest one.
